Description

The problem with court politicians is their ability to stab someone in the back repeatedly.


Skharr DeathEater, the Barbarian of Theros, friend of dwarves and emperors, is a liability.


The mysterious Dealer in Whispers and Death has let it be known in the right ears they can kill Skharr DeathEater-for a hell of a price.


The Dealer has never failed to kill their target in the over two hundred years of their existence, and they love a good challenge.


Can Skharr get himself out of this? Will his friends allow him to go it alone?


Even the emperor is shocked to learn he must wait to find out what happens.


Will Skharr survive the Assassin's Trial for a killing he didn't commit (this time)? If he does, how will he attack a phantom no one can find?
